@ trong python là gì?

Em mới làm quen với python không biết cái @ này dùng để làm gì vậy ạ mong mọi người chỉ giúp ạ

class MyController(odoo.http.Controller):
      @route('/some_url', auth='public')
    def handler(self):
      return stuff()

Cái đó gọi là function annotation (còn có tên khác là decorator) nha bạn.
Còn cụ thể thì cái trong code của bạn là cái này

7 Likes
83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?